There are, however, limitations in SPM. For example, there are no alternative to a piezoelectric actuator for the scanning device, and friction force can be only detected by torsion of the cantilever. Thus, micro-fabrication technologies were applied to enhance the potential of SPM for tribology study. In this presentation, the author introduces two kinds of micro devices in order to improve SPM measurement; FIB processed micro-cantilevers, micro lateral force sensors and three-dimensional (3D) micro stages.
